Summary

Amends the School Code. With respect to the report that a school district submits to the State Board of Education if the district receives an Early Childhood Education Block Grant and the report that the Chicago school district submits to the State Board on the use of its general education and educational services block grants, provides that if the district does not submit the report to the State Board in a timely manner then the State Board shall withhold all payments owed to the district until the report is submitted, reviewed, and made public by the State Board. Effective July 1, 2014.
